Output 59bbfa57e8e4e7dbb300419fc3a96db54f641ab789d0a9a467e191d2f7dbfbf9:1

value
2448892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 540711b12ef850e4ee1176b1d434bc46d497ffd3 OP_EQUALVERIFY OP_CHECKSIG
address
18fJEHUmz9nDKtZfn6hqsGuxihzzsJ9DLE
transaction
59bbfa57e8e4e7dbb300419fc3a96db54f641ab789d0a9a467e191d2f7dbfbf9
confirmations
329852
spent
true